VIVERE is a 2011 Southerly 57RS Raised Saloon cutter designed by Ed Dubois and built by Northshore Yachts in the United Kingdom. As the flagship of the Southerly variable-draft range, the 57RS was created to bring together true ocean-crossing ability, shallow-water freedom, elegant raised-saloon living, and shorthanded sailing systems in a yacht under 60 feet.


The design brief is immediately clear: VIVERE was built for owners who want to sail far, live aboard comfortably, and reach anchorages that most yachts of this size cannot access. With her hydraulic swing keel, she draws approximately 4’ with the keel raised and 10’9” with the keel fully deployed, giving her both shoal-draft freedom and powerful windward ability. Twin rudders, a long waterline, fine entry, beam carried well aft, and a substantial grounding plate create a yacht that is stable offshore, easy to manage, and unusually versatile for her length.


On deck, VIVERE offers a large, secure aft sailing cockpit, twin carbon wheels, redundant helm electronics, push-button sail handling, bow and stern thrusters, a hydraulic transom door, and a Williams jet tender housed in the garage. Below, the Raised Saloon is bright and commanding, with Dubois’ signature teardrop windows, Crown Cut teak joinery, leather and stainless accents, and a Rhoades Young interior that feels more like a small superyacht than a conventional production cruiser.


VIVERE is also thoughtfully updated, with a 150 HP Yanmar 4LV150 diesel, lithium house bank, 800 W solar array, watermaker, updated B&G electronics, Starlink, recent drivetrain improvements, and a new Code Zero. She is a rare offering for a buyer who wants serious bluewater capability, luxury liveaboard comfort, and the freedom to cruise shallow waters without sacrificing sailing performance.

Construction And Key Features Of The Hull And Deck

HULL

VIVERE was designed by Ed Dubois and built by Northshore Yachts as the flagship of the Southerly variable-draft range. Her hull form carries a fine entry, long waterline, and beam aft for stability, interior volume, and confident offshore motion. The hydraulic swing keel is central to the design, allowing shallow-water access with the keel raised and true deep-keel sailing performance when deployed.

  • Fiberglass monohull construction
  • Hydraulic variable-draft swing keel with approximately 4’ to 10’9” draft range
  • Twin rudders for control and grounding support
  • Substantial grounding keel plate designed to allow the yacht to safely take the ground
  • Long waterline, fine plumb entry, and beam carried aft for stability and volume
  • Designed by Ed Dubois and built by Northshore Yachts in the United Kingdom

VIVERE is one of the most compelling yachts in the sub-60-foot bluewater market because she does something very few yachts can do well: she combines serious offshore ability, refined luxury, shorthanded sailing systems, and true shoal-draft freedom in one yacht. The Southerly 57RS is not another conventional center-cockpit cruiser. She is a modern raised-saloon, variable-draft offshore yacht with a signature Dubois profile, an elegant Rhoades Young interior, and the structural intent of a yacht designed for real voyaging.


The swing keel is the headline feature, but it is not a gimmick. Keel down, VIVERE has the bite, righting moment, and windward ability expected of a serious offshore yacht. Keel up, she opens up shallow anchorages, rivers, Bahamas-style cruising grounds, and tucked-away harbors that most 57-foot yachts simply cannot reach. Her ability to safely take the ground on the keel pad and twin rudders further expands her cruising possibilities and makes her a uniquely practical long-distance yacht.
